The Shocking Final Move
Baldur’s Gate 3 enthusiasts continue to uncover astonishing combat moments, with Auntie Ethel’s ultimate betrayal standing as a prime example of the game’s sophisticated AI design.
A particularly devastating encounter shared by Reddit user Valuable_Ant_969 demonstrates how the game’s antagonists can deliver heartbreaking surprises even in their final moments.
During the climactic battle in the Riverside Teahouse, when Ethel’s health reached critical levels—typically triggering her surrender dialogue—the player strategically deployed Cloud of Daggers to secure victory on the subsequent turn.
However, the cunning hag had one last malicious trick prepared. As the player recounted: “While the combat log provided limited clarity, Ethel apparently utilized her terminal action to employ Auntie’s Trickery, forcibly relocating Mayrina directly into the lethal Cloud of Daggers alongside herself. The emotional impact was profound enough that I committed to this tragic outcome without reloading.”
This calculated final act left the gaming community simultaneously horrified and admiring of the game’s narrative commitment.
“One must acknowledge the impressive design, however frustrating the result,” observed one community member.
“Hags inherently defy trust—this encounter reinforces that fundamental truth,” added another participant.

Advanced Combat Strategies
Learning from this devastating outcome, experienced players have developed sophisticated countermeasures to prevent Ethel’s final betrayal while still achieving optimal results.
Positioning Prevention Tactics: Deploy party members to physically block Ethel’s line of sight to Mayrina during the encounter’s final phase. Utilize characters with high Strength to create human barriers, or employ summoned creatures as living shields.
Crowd Control Solutions: Time your Hold Person or Tasha’s Hideous Laughter spells to coincide with Ethel’s low-health threshold. Paralysis or incapacitation effects prevent ability usage during her final turn.
Environmental Mastery: Position area-of-effect spells carefully to maximize damage to Ethel while minimizing risk to Mayrina. Consider using Wall of Fire or Hunger of Hadar with precise placement rather than Cloud of Daggers’ persistent damage field.
Action Economy Optimization: Coordinate party actions to deliver overwhelming damage in a single round once Ethel reaches 20% health, eliminating her before she can execute desperate measures. Surprise rounds or readied actions prove particularly effective.
Common Strategic Errors: Many players mistakenly focus solely on damage output without considering Ethel’s capabilities. Never assume she’ll surrender peacefully—always prepare for malicious final actions. Additionally, positioning Mayrina near environmental hazards creates unnecessary vulnerability.
